在C语言中,逻辑值可以使用以下两种方式表示:
专注于为中小企业提供成都网站制作、成都做网站服务,电脑端+手机端+微信端的三站合一,更高效的管理,为中小企业普陀免费做网站提供优质的服务。我们立足成都,凝聚了一批互联网行业人才,有力地推动了成百上千家企业的稳健成长,帮助中小企业通过网站建设实现规模扩充和转变。
1、使用预定义的宏
C语言提供了三个预定义的宏来表示逻辑值:
TRUE
:表示真(非零值)
FALSE
:表示假(零值)
NULL
:表示空指针或无效值
你可以使用这些宏来声明和初始化布尔类型的变量。
#includeint main() { bool is_valid = TRUE; // 声明并初始化布尔变量为真 if (is_valid) { printf("Valid data "); } else { printf("Invalid data "); } return 0; }
2、使用标准库中的头文件
从C99标准开始,C语言引入了一个名为
以下是使用
#include#include int main() { bool is_valid = true; // 声明并初始化布尔变量为真 if (is_valid) { printf("Valid data "); } else { printf("Invalid data "); } return 0; }
请注意,在使用